WebPreparations by the Commission for a general election in Malaysia start as early as a year before the perceived date of elections. While the dates involving the election process are fixed by the Commission, such dates can only be fixed after the Government in power dissolves Parliament or State Assemblies. WebAug 1, 2013 · The outcome of Malaysia’s 13th General Election (GE13) is still contested. Some argue that since Pakatan Rakyat won the popular vote, Barisan Nasional therefore does not have the legitimacy to rule. But all political parties entered the election knowing that popular vote is not the deciding factor in a parliamentary system.
